Glasses are not simply a tool to correct vision or UV protection, but also a fashion item to dress up. The trend of spectacles has changed dramatically in the past 80 years. It follows the changes of the times, with the combination of material and art, through the tangible way to reflect. Want to know what glasses have been popular in Europe and the United States for decades?

1930s

The primary need for women's glasses is thin. The most stylish are frameless hexagonal transparent glasses and round sunglasses. Men at the time liked this saddle-style round-framed glasses and celluloid pilot round-framed glasses. 1940s

The classic cat-eye look, accompanied by a variety of stunning color schemes, has been popular among women since the 1940s. Compared with men, people prefer metal-encrusted round-framed glasses and metal aviator-style glasses. In fact, this type of glasses is not much different from the 30's.

1950s

After World War II, Aviator sunglasses became popular. At the same time, the cat-eye series of sunglasses also incorporate more industrial design elements. In 1950, the shape of men's sunglasses evolved from a circle to an oval shape. People love the eyebrow-line combination sunglasses and traveler-style sunglasses worn by rock star Buddy Hawley.

1960s

By the 1960s, Jacqueline, the wife of former U.S. President John F. Kennedy, had rewritten the history of the female eyewear trend. People start to pay more attention to large round-framed sunglasses. This classic frame has swept the fashion world like a storm. Men prefer large-framed plastic P3 glasses and Olympian-style glasses, making every man to be James Bond.

1980s

A decade passed, sunglasses are beginning to match brighter colors and are decorated with colorful ornaments that accentuate women's charms. Men, on the other hand, prefer a bulging hairstyle, locomotive jacket and oversized metallic sunglasses and mirrored sunglasses.

1990s

By the 1990s, the 'small, thin' frame was popular with most women. Since the 1990s, fine-framed glasses and sporty half-framed sports sunglasses have become popular among men.

Today's sunglasses add a little retro, blend into a new style, and creat a new trend.
